New Wilhelmshaven high school: 26,000 euros for children in need!

A happy get-together took place in Wilhelmshaven's city park in September when the students of the New High School took part in an exciting fundraising run. With a lot of ambition and full commitment, they collected something proud that day26,000 euros. This impressive result was recently announced by headmaster Stefan Fischer and director of studies Dr. Wiebke Endres announced in the school auditorium, which led to great cheers among the students and teachers. The majority of the proceeds will be invested in a new play module for the schoolyard, which will include a large slide and hanging swings and a total of up to40,000 eurosshould cost.

What is particularly pleasing is that3,000 eurosThe amount collected goes to the “ChaKa” association, which supports various children's projects. This includes, among other things, the distribution of winter jackets140 kindergarten childrenas well as special education for children with a migrant background. “ChaKa” relies on donations to continue to support important programs that promote social cohesion in the community. The club has already proven that it has a good knack for giving children a better future.

Successful collaboration with sponsors

The fundraising run experienced a quiet but warm and impressive thank-you event: external sponsors made a significant contribution to the success of this event and were duly acknowledged by the school management. The supporters included, among others,Rüstringen building association, theSparkasse Wilhelmshavenand theVolksbank Jever. This strong network of local business owners shows that word of commitment to children and education can quickly spread throughout the community. It's great to see local businesses coming together to support young people.

Another aspect of the fundraising run: the amount was divided among different organizations. So flow1,500 eurosto the popular adventure playground Voslapp and2,500 eurosto the Wilhelmshaven table. This also shows the importance of support from the school's support association, which not only takes care of the needs of the students, but also supports people in need in the region.
